Church of St James
Church
Photo: Saffron Blaze, CC BY-SA 3.0.
The Anglican Church of St James at Chipping Campden in the Cotswold District of Gloucestershire, England, was built in the 15th century incorporating an earlier Norman church. It is a grade I listed building. Church of St James is situated 2,300 feet northwest of Cam Farm.

Ebrington
Village
Photo: David P Howard, CC BY-SA 2.0.
Ebrington is a village and civil parish in Gloucestershire, England, about 2 miles from Chipping Campden. It has narrow lanes and tiny streets of Cotswold stone houses and cottages, many of which are thatched. Ebrington is situated 2 miles east of Cam Farm.
Aston-sub-Edge
Hamlet
Photo: David Luther Thomas, CC BY-SA 2.0.
Aston Subedge is a village and civil parish in the Cotswold district of Gloucestershire, England, close by the border with Worcestershire. According to the 2001 census the population was 55, increasing to 107 at the 2011 census. Aston-sub-Edge is situated 2 miles northwest of Cam Farm.
